PodFest Cairo 2021 - Virtual, Egypt and Africa’s first podcasting conference, took place on Sunday, March 7, 2021 on Zoom. The event was hosted by AUC’s Department of Journalism and Mass Communication (JRMC) and provided simultaneous translation.

The two-and-a-half hour event brought together Egypt’s podcast listeners and creators. The line-up featured keynote speaker Linah Mohmmad from the Washington Post’s Post Reports Podcast, who spoke about growing up in Jordan before moving to Texas and her introduction to audio via National Public Radio (NPR) in the U.S. Mohammed ended her segment by discussing her recent audio essay, “Bachelorette in Arlington” that was published on This American Life.

Other sessions included “The Road to a Successful Podcast” with Noran Morsi, host and producer of the recently launched Egyptian Streets Podcast along with Heba Shunbo, the host of Mommy’s Happy Hour Podcast, which launched last year. They spoke of the successes and challenges they’ve experienced with their new podcasts.

In the session “Telling Narratives in Arabic,” Tala Eissa from Sowt spoke of the challenges of de-centering English when it comes to podcasting. Several local podcasts and podcasters were spotlighted in one of the last segments of the event. PodFest Cairo 2021 - Virtual concluded with several rounds of speed networking, a chance for the attendees to mingle and get to know each other in a short period of time.

Kim Fox, the founder and conference organizer says, “The podcasting scene is growing in Cairo and Egypt and we want to continue to share resources to encourage the production of podcasts.” The PodFest Cairo team is available for consultations.
